Abstract
The anisotropic porous model covering the bristles bending deflections was used to establish the calculation model. The effect of bristles for the flow media was considered a resistance force, which was added into N-S equation as a source term. The model was established on the basis of the Finite Volume Method and the SIMPLE method. To this effect, the pressure field, velocity vectors distribution and leakage of brush seal were obtained from calculation of flow field. The influences of main parameters, such as: structure and working condition, on the sealing performance of brush seals, were analyzed and compared, showing that this method is suitable for the study of the brush seals.
